Why are Motivational Golf Quotes Important?
The mental game in golf is paramount. It's not enough to have a perfect swing; you need the mental strength to overcome setbacks and maintain a positive attitude even when facing adversity. Motivational quotes serve as powerful tools to:
- Boost Confidence: Reading or hearing inspiring words can help you believe in your abilities and approach the game with more confidence.
- Maintain Focus: When things get tough, a motivational quote can refocus your attention on the task at hand and prevent you from dwelling on mistakes.
- Improve Resilience: Golf is a game of constant challenges. Motivational quotes can help you develop resilience and bounce back from setbacks.
- Enhance Positivity: Maintaining a positive attitude is essential for success in golf. Inspirational quotes can help cultivate a more optimistic outlook.
Inspiring Golf Quotes to Keep You Going
Here are some powerful golf quotes to inspire you on and off the course:
"Golf is a game of inches. The difference between a good shot and a great shot is an inch. The difference between a good round and a great round is an inch." - Bobby Jones
This quote highlights the importance of precision and consistency in golf. Every little detail matters, and striving for perfection in every aspect of your game can lead to significant improvements.
"Golf is deceptively simple and endlessly complicated." - Arnold Palmer
This quote encapsulates the inherent paradox of golf: its simplicity in concept versus its complexity in execution. It reminds us to approach the game with humility and respect for its challenges.
"The most important shot in golf is the next one." - Ben Hogan
This is arguably the most famous and impactful golf quote. It emphasizes the importance of letting go of past mistakes and focusing on the present moment. Dwelling on a bad shot only hinders your performance in the next shot.
What is the most important thing in golf?
The most important thing in golf is often debated, but it boils down to a combination of factors: mental fortitude, consistent practice, and a strong understanding of the game's fundamentals. While a perfect swing is certainly valuable, mental resilience, the ability to manage pressure, and maintaining a positive attitude are arguably more crucial for consistent success.
What are the benefits of playing golf?
Golf offers numerous benefits beyond the enjoyment of the game. It's a great form of exercise, improving cardiovascular health and muscle strength. The game also fosters mental focus, strategic thinking, and patience. Finally, it's a fantastic social activity, providing opportunities to connect with others and build relationships.
How can I improve my golf game?
Improving your golf game requires a multifaceted approach. Consistent practice on your swing, short game, and putting is paramount. Consider taking lessons from a qualified instructor to refine your technique and address any flaws in your swing. Working on your mental game, including techniques for managing pressure and maintaining focus, is equally crucial. Finally, analyzing your game and identifying areas for improvement through regular play and self-assessment will contribute greatly to your progress.
